Output 63de13419db5582c2021bb44ae4700b5178e2bc11588332132ce886186e18e85:3

value
304957
script pubkey
OP_0 OP_PUSHBYTES_20 f0e59980e372f98751d02c28baa09fb21d6cab8d
address
bc1q7rjenq8rwtucw5ws9s5t4gylkgwke2udwh6kg2
transaction
63de13419db5582c2021bb44ae4700b5178e2bc11588332132ce886186e18e85
spent
true